Vol. 33 No. 2 (2025): Innovation, Governance, Education, and Economic Progress
This Issue brings together original research on innovation, governance, education, and economic progress, reflecting the interconnected nature of sustainable development in a rapidly evolving global environment. The articles explore technological innovation, public governance, educational reforms, policy implementation, entrepreneurship, digital transformation, and strategies for inclusive economic growth. Through rigorous theoretical and empirical investigations, the contributions provide valuable insights into improving institutional effectiveness, fostering innovation-driven development, and strengthening educational systems. This issue serves as a valuable resource for researchers, policymakers, educators, and practitioners by promoting evidence-based solutions that support resilient institutions, economic advancement, and long-term societal well-being.
